Eat Healthy

If you want to save your mental health during the final week, you should eat healthy meals. It’s really important to change your nutrition plan and stick to a wholesome diet.

In case if you will continue to have a cheeseburger and French fries with soda for breakfasts, lunches, and dinners, your brain will not get enough nutritive elements. As a result, you will not be able to cope with the stress.

However, if you increase the consumption of products, which contains vitamins C, B1, B9, and minerals calcium, magnesium, and zinc, you will protect your mental health. These nutritive elements will help you to hit the following goals:

  • Protect healthy brain function
  • Reduce anxiety
  • Put the stress level down
  • Boost short-term memory
  • Improve mood
  • Delay brain shrinkage.

Find Time for Your Hobbies

If you really care about your mental health, you shouldn’t study 24/7. You should spend at least one hour a day on your hobbies. A final test is not the only thing, which matters in your life, is it?

Do you like to write poems, paint portraits or play chess? When you feel tired, put your books away and enjoy the activities, which you like the most. It will help you to take your thoughts away from the exams and let your brain relax.

This is an effective way to calm down the nerves and make you feel more peaceful. Moreover, this is a great approach to reveal your creativity and cope with essay writing.

Sleep Well

If you sleep less than 7 hours a day, you are at risk of mental disease development. Your mind and body need time to heal themselves during the night. So, if you often stay up late and wake up early, it’s time to set a normal sleep schedule.

Train Hard

Physical activity is beneficial not only for your body but also for your mind. It helps you in the following ways:

  • Distracts from negative thoughts
  • Reduces the stress level
  • Improves mood (it happens because levels of serotonin and endorphins go up)
  • Reduces skeletal muscle tension and, consequently, make you feel more relaxed
  • Fights anxiety and depression
  • Improves sleep

You can do any kind of physical exercises you like. You can train at home, attend yoga classes, swim or play football. Just make sure that you exercise at least 20 minutes every day.

Drink Enough Water

As you know, the human brain consists of water by 75%. When you don’t drink enough, blood flow gets lower, and less oxygen reaches the brain. For this reason, if your body is dehydrated, you have a bad mood and can’t focus your attention on studying.

Fortunately, you can manage this issue easily. Consuming at least 8 glasses of water a day, you can make sure that your brain works effectively enough. You can install an app on your phone, which will remind you to drink water during a day.

 

Stay Motivated

Motivation plays an important role in the life of every college student. Surprisingly, motivation is also interrelated with mental health. Those individuals, who have clear career goals, find it easier to deal with the stress during finals.

The point is that when people know what they want to achieve, they understand why they should study so hard. It’s much easier to move toward your dreams when you clearly see them on the horizon.

So, how you can stay motivated all the time? There are few tips:

  • Make a list of your life goals and read them daily.
  • Create a vision board. Describe all the privileges you will get in the future thanks to your higher education.
  • Print out the motivational quotes. Follow the example of successful people.
